
Canmore: Canyons and Cave Paintings Hiking Tour – Canadian Rockies, Canada
Enjoy the sights of Canmore’s most picturesque scenery on a canyons and cave paintings hiking tour with an expert guide. Explore the narrow-walled creek bed and indigenous pictographs hidden in the cave walls.
EXPERIENCE:
Embark on a hiking tour by meeting your guide at the designated meeting point. From there, depart on a short 15-minute drive to the trailhead.
Explore the narrow-walled creek bed which twists and turns for many kilometers. Reach a fork in the creek bed as the smooth limestone walls get steeper and steeper. Head right to see a glistening waterfall.
Discover ancient, indigenous pictographs hidden in the cave walls and learn about the history that has almost been lost in time. The tour is offered in the summer and winter.
In the winter, ice cleats and hiking poles are supplied. Exploring the canyon in the winter is a very unique and rewarding experience. Go deep into the canyon with your ice cleats allowing you to go into more unexplored areas.
